Coronation Street spoilers follow from Wednesday’s episode (18 February), which is available to watch now on ITVX and YouTube, but hasn’t yet aired on ITV1.
Coronation Street has confirmed Lauren Bolton as the latest target of Maggie Driscoll’s wrath – but with a shock death on the way, could the tables ultimately turn on the spiteful matriarch? Maggie was recently named as one of the characters who could be killed off in April, so fans are sure to watch her scenes closely in the next two months.
Earlier this week, Maggie was signposted as one of five regular characters who may lose their life in a major plot twist. Betsy Swain finds a body just hours after Lisa and Carla’s long-awaited wedding ceremony, casting a shadow over the day of celebration.
Maggie already has a history of upsetting people with her cutting remarks, including members of her own family. But it seems that, for now, Lauren is the main focus of her attention.
In tonight’s episode, Maggie confirms that she’s been meddling with the Rovers Return rotas to restrict Lauren’s chances of spending time with Ollie.

As far as Maggie is concerned, Lauren simply isn’t good enough for her beloved grandson – and she’ll do whatever she can to keep them apart.
“Lauren is a misery guts single mother from a bad family and has a terrible history with men,” Maggie complains in a chat with Ben and Eva. “That might be fine for some people, but not for my grandson.”
And showing that she still has it in for Eva too, Maggie quips: “Mind you, he wouldn’t be the first man in this family to be blinded by an airhead bottle-blonde with no concept of modesty.”
Later, malicious Maggie takes her concerns directly to Ollie – putting him on the spot with a series of cruel jibes about Lauren’s past and their suitability as a couple.

Ollie tries to bat away his grandmother’s comments, but we suspect she’s only just getting started when it comes to antagonising Lauren…
Given Maggie’s history of lashing out, could a showdown with Lauren ultimately go horribly wrong by backfiring on her? Or could someone in Maggie’s own family strike out in the heat of the moment? Viewers should definitely watch closely to see if Maggie is being set up for a revenge twist.
Carl Webster, Jodie Ramsey, Megan Walsh and Theo Silverton have been named as the other four characters in danger of being killed off when Lisa and Carla’s wedding takes place on 23 April.
